Typically the service is provided by a lease arrangement and the provider can, in some configurations, use the exact same switching devices to service multiple hosted PBX clients. The first hosted PBX services were feature-rich compared to the majority of premises-based systems of the time. Some PBX functions, such as follow-me calling, appeared in a hosted service before they appeared in hardware PBX equipment.
This permits one extension to ring in multiple areas (either concurrently or sequentially) (Best Multi Line Phone System for Small Business). enables scalability so that a bigger system is not required if new workers are worked with, therefore that resources are not wasted if the variety of staff members is decreased. gets rid of the requirement for companies to handle or pay for on-site hardware upkeep.

But our favorite feature of the system is its special "Vi" (Voice Intelligence) analytics include, which processes your conversations as they happen and transcribes them into a quickly understandable format. Somewhat futuristically, it can recognise action products that turn up throughout your calls and immediately style them into order of business for you, while also making note of unfavorable and positive sentiments in the discussion.
What we discover most compelling about this system, however, is how adjustable its prices bundles are. Instead of signing your entire group onto one cost plan, you can blend and match putting some staff member onto the least expensive, the majority of fundamental plan, and others onto the more pricey tiers. This makes a lot of sense when you have some employee who'll just need the system to make infrequent calls and participate on team conferences and collaborations, and others who'll need more sophisticated features, such as call recording, voicemail transcription, and combination with the CRM platform they use.
